Pros

Their 401k is not bad, and my coworkers are generally good people.

Cons

Management is discriminatory and hard work gets you nowhere in the company due to favoritism. Regularly put down and singled out and management/HR doesn't care, I've literally been told by HR to 'get over it' when going to them for help. I've gone nearly three years with no raise due to 'restructuring'. Also work 50+ hour work weeks because management doesn't know how to manage the place.

Pros

The people in non- upper management roles that work there are fantastic. Great sense of community onsite and the culture champions are consistently looking for ways to make work life better.

Cons

Very poor communication on the strategy for the business unit. Leadership publicly promotes innovation and new ideas to be presented but then those ideas are shot down or penalized in private by current upper management. The business unit leadership says that don't want excuses for project delays but will then decide to do 3 major layoffs in the first two quarters with no transition plan, no support for gap in resources and no expectations to delayed progress.
